My two cents for those considering Tesla's floor mats..
I own the 3D MAXpider mats for my late 2017 MX (RIP). The main difference is the ability to hold liquid. If you live in a colder climate area and track dirty snow into your warm car, as soon as you round a corner let alone a Plaid launch all that dirty water flies right off the mat. I am waiting for them to release the updated mats.
